Frequently Asked Questions
-
What is ton-force (long)?
-
Ton-force (long) is an imperial force unit equal to the weight of one long ton (2,240 pounds) under standard gravity, often used historically in British engineering.
-
Why convert ton-force (long) to giganewton?
-
This conversion updates legacy force measurements into modern SI units, enabling use in current engineering, aerospace, and geophysical applications.
-
Is the ton-force (long) unit still used today?
-
It is primarily a historical unit with limited direct practical use in modern measurements.
Key Terminology
-
Ton-force (long)
-
An imperial unit of force based on the weight of one long ton (2,240 pounds) under standard gravity.
-
Giganewton (GN)
-
An SI-derived unit of force equal to 10^9 newtons, used for measuring extremely large forces.
-
Standard Gravity
-
The conventional acceleration due to gravity, defined as 9.80665 meters per second squared.
